Role Overview
We are seeking a seasoned Hardware Engineering Manager to lead a team of talented engineers in the design, development, and production of cutting-edge hardware solutions. This role will play a critical part in driving innovation and ensuring the successful delivery of high-quality products that align with our strategic goals.
Responsibilities
- Lead and mentor a multidisciplinary team of hardware engineers, fostering a collaborative and innovative team environment.
- Oversee the full hardware development lifecycle, from concept through to production, ensuring that projects are delivered on time and within budget.
- Define and implement engineering best practices, processes, and methodologies to enhance productivity and product quality.
- Collaborate with cross-functional teams including software, product management, and quality assurance to define requirements and ensure seamless integration of hardware and software components.
- Develop and manage project timelines, resource allocation, and risk assessments to proactively address potential challenges.
- Conduct regular performance reviews and provide guidance to team members, facilitating their professional growth and development.
- Stay abreast of industry trends and emerging technologies to identify opportunities for innovation and improvement.
Required and Preferred Qualifications
Required:
- 5+ years of experience in hardware engineering, with at least 2 years in a leadership role managing engineering teams.
- Proven track record of successfully bringing hardware products to market, including experience with product lifecycle management.
- Strong understanding of electrical engineering principles, circuit design, and embedded systems.
- Experience with project management tools and methodologies, including Agile/Scrum.
- Excellent communication and interpersonal skills, with the ability to collaborate effectively across diverse teams.
Preferred:
- Advanced degree in Electrical Engineering or related field.
- Experience with consumer electronics or IoT hardware development.
- Familiarity with design validation and reliability testing methodologies.
Technical Skills and Relevant Technologies
- Expertise in PCB design and layout using tools such as Altium or KiCAD.
- Proficiency in simulation tools and software for circuit analysis.
- Knowledge of regulatory standards for hardware products, including FCC, CE, and RoHS compliance.
